- The distance between Primorsko-Ahtarsk, Russia and Port Hedland, Australia is approximately 10,921 km or 6,787 mi.
- To reach Primorsko-Ahtarsk in this distance one would set out from Port Hedland bearing 316.2°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Primorsko-Ahtarsk bearing 290.9° or WNW .
- Primorsko-Ahtarsk has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Port Hedland has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Primorsko-Ahtarsk is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Port Hedland is in or near the tropical thorn woodland biome.
- The mean temperature is 15.2 °C (27.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 14.9 °C (26.8°F) more in Primorsko-Ahtarsk.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 274.3 mm (10.8 in) more which is equivalent to 274.3 l/m² (6.73 US gal/ft²) or 2,743,000 l/ha (293,245 US gal/ac) more. About 1 7/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.9° lower in Primorsko-Ahtarsk than in Port Hedland.
